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ations
- Guarding features: Look for a built-in nail guard or adjustable guard to minimize quick-cutting risk, especially important for small breeds with sensitive quicks.
- Blade design: Conical or rounded blades reduce the chance of catching skin. Stainless steel blades provide longevity and a clean cut.
- Ergonomics and grip: Non-slip handles with comfortable texture reduce hand fatigue during longer grooming sessions.
- Size compatibility: For Maltese nails, prefer clippers with small- to medium-aperture blades and precision tips for careful trimming.
- Versatility: Some models support multiple pets or coat types, offering more value for households with more than one pet.
- Maintenance: Easy-to-clean blades and included nail files help maintain hygiene between uses.
